Job Description
As a Senior Integrations Developer on this team, you will be a key technical contributor in the integration space, working with Oracle's leading Integration Cloud products. You will participate in the architecture, design, and development of complex OIC solutions, requiring strong development, technical, and communication skills. You will help manage project priorities, deadlines, and deliverables. Additionally, you will play a role in defining and evolving standard practices and procedures within the software engineering division, leveraging your technical and business skills to contribute as an individual and team member, providing guidance and support to others.

Minimum Qualifications:
- 5+ years in software development or related field.
- 7+ years experience delivering integration, SOA, or API-based solutions.
- Hands-on experience developing at least one full lifecycle project using OIC, SOA, and API products.
- Expertise in integrating SaaS applications and on-premises application software.
- Proficiency in web services and XML technologies.
- Strong understanding and experience with SOA and RESTful services.
- Proficiency in at least two of Oracle’s four broad areas of offerings: infrastructure, database, middleware, and analytics.
- BS or MS degree or equivalent experience relevant to functional area.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Hands-on experience in DevOps tools, end-to-end integration solutions, and implementation of OIC, VBCS, PCS, MFT CS, SOA CS, Oracle BPEL, OSB, and B2B.
- Implementation experience with Oracle Business Activity Monitoring (BAM) and administration/tuning experience with Oracle WebLogic Server.
